FALL INSPO: LEATHER + KNITS

posted on: Tuesday, August 12, 2014

I'm sure you're all feeling the fall fever as much as I am. Around this time of year, I always find myself wishing away the heat and longing for chilly days wrapped in cozy sweaters, spent pumpkin picking, or at my favorite fairs. Autumn style is something I love because it lets me mix my love for leather and all things soft. These pieces are things I hope to make staples in my fall wardrobe.


1.) Silence and Noise Marled Open-Stitch Sweater - Not only am I in love with the colors this comes in, but I'm a sucker for open stitch. Whether I'd want to layer this over a dress or a patterned button up clean finished with a collar, it's super versatile.

2.) Jakimac Single Chain Draped Leather Harness - I have never owned a harness before, but when I  found Jakimac, I fell in love with their pieces and the way they style them. I'd love to edge up a cute sweater dress with this! Follow them on instagram to see their styling and get inspired!

3.) Free People Side by Side Pullover - How cozy does this look?! Paired with some ripped denim and killer boots, this could effortlessly turn into a go-to look.

4.) Free People Top of The World Thigh Hi - Ribbed thigh high socks are a must for me in the fall months. I love them peeking out of a midi boot, or letting them shine with a pair of oxfords or ankle boots.

5.) Cooperative Oliver Structured Backpack - I always switch up my backpacks with the seasons. The fall semester is near and I need something thats cute but functional. I love this clean and classic look. The navy and leather straps are what drew me to this beauty!

6.) Modern Vice "Rita" Boot - I'm still in awe of how perfect these are. I definitely see myself pairing these with tights and a softer more feminine dress and chunky cardigan.

SPRING THINGS

posted on: Tuesday, March 4, 2014

 Well Bloomers I can honestly say I've been dreaming of spring for well over a week now. Although warm sunshine seems far, it's really around the corner and it's good to start thinking about spring style! I put together a small assortment of items I LOVE and can't wait to wear! Hopefully you all can find some inspiration.


1. Panama hats- I've always been one for hats, and panama hats have me pumped for warm days and messy hair. Pair it with a tunic and jeans, or pretty sun dress/maxi dress for a girly feel. Pictured: Wool Women's Panama Hat by Tilly's

2. Lace (and more lace!)- Being a fan of anything vintage, lace dresses, tunics, and kimonos have me swooning. Take a bohemian lace piece and pair it with something black or leather for an edgier vibe. Pictured: One Golden Age top by Free People

3. Printed Maxi Skirts- Maxi skirts have been a style that lives strong for the warmer months, but this spring I'm excited to take them to a new level. Printed maxis, like this daisy one, are comfortable yet show stopping. pair this with a crop top or bustier and a strappy vintage boot. Not to mention some awesome rings! Pictured: Flower Child M-slit Maxi Skirt by Forever 21

4. Detailed Accessories- This handmade leather pouch is a perfect accessory to carry with you all through the warmer months. A raw, harsh textile against some feminine flare can complete any look. This pouch here I'm crazy about because it was hand sewn in Haiti by Fait La Force. This product is being featured on a website that is most definitely worth taking the time to check out. This girl, Bekah, is doing something really awesome! Pictured: Raw Edge Pouch by A Well Traveled Brand

5. Bustier Tops- These tops never grow old because I love all the different ways to pair them! Whether it's with a maxi skirt, high waisted shorts, skater skirt or high waisted denim, this top becomes a very versatile piece of spring! Pictured: Banded Strapless Top by Sparkle & Fade for Urban Outfitters

6. Floral Dresses- This is a staple to my spring wardrobe, and although I have many floral dresses, I still feel like you can never have enough! How cute are they paired with a kimono or fringe vest? Or you can even leave them plain and simple and they're great! Pictured: Lace-Up Babydoll Tank Dress by Band of Gypsies

7. Oversized Rings- These rings are acceptable every time of year, but these vibrant turquoise stones accent the colors of spring. This can be worn and loved with any outfit! Pictured: This Triple Turquoise Ring is crafted by St. Eve Jewelry

8. Cut-Out Ankle Boots- Sandals will always be a spring and summer favorite, but why not spice up your footwear with something more funky? Cut-out, strappy ankle boots are such an awesome way to change the dynamic of an outfit. They can be worn with long, flowy silhouettes, or something more sculpted and geometric! Pictured: Stillwell Fisherman Ankle Boot by Jeffrey Campbell

9. Fringe Vests- Bringing back the 70's in a fun, bohemian way! This vest is statement piece and can be easily turned too far back in time, so it's nice to spice it up in a modern way. Wear this with a dark lip and some wedged buckle sandals for a current bohemian look. There's so many ways to work this vest, make it true to you! Pictured: Vintage Suede Vest by Tea Stained Lace on Etsy


I hope you all found a bit of inspiration and excitement for spring! It's coming soon, so enjoy putting together some outfit ideas. You'll look killer for that first warm day ;)
